The Lost-Wax Casting Process: Precision in Every Step
Creating a functional toothbrush required more than melting gold. Diamonds Inc. used a replaceable-bristle design for practicality, then replicated the handle through meticulous steps:
- Dental Mold Creation: A dental school crafted an exact handle model, essential for comfort during brushing.
- Wax Replication: Jewelers made wax copies of the model for the investment casting process.
- Fusion at 1,900°F: The Play Button melted in a furnace—gold’s boiling point demands expert temperature control.
- Casting & Refinement: Molten gold filled the mold, cooled, then underwent sandblasting and hand-polishing.

Performance vs. Aesthetics: Real-World Testing
The 24K gold handle paired with Swedish ultra-soft bristles underwent rigorous testing:
- Cleaning Efficacy: Scored 8.5/10—effective plaque removal but struggled with tight gaps.
- Ergonomics: Weighted gold provided balanced grip, reducing hand fatigue.
- Drawbacks: The luxury toothpaste’s bitterness highlighted flavor compromises in niche products.
